READERS…READERS…AND MORE READERS!

This year your child will be bringing home LOTS of emergent readers.  They look like this….

img_0049

They are paper booklets that we work on in our classroom as a big group and in small groups with our wonderful parapros (teachers who support learning).

We call these books “JUST RIGHT” books, as they are just right for your child to read to you!

I am hoping that when your child brings home a “Just Right” emergent reader that parents, brothers, sisters, grandmas, grandpas, or whoever may live in your house will allow your child to read it to you.

The more your child practices reading these books the more confident reader he/she will be.  He/she will also learn to read with fluency by rereading the book to many different people, and start to remember the story (comprehension).  You can create a library of these books right in your child’s bedroom so they have easy access to them.  I have done this with my own children.  They LOVE IT!

These books are also packed full of “POPCORN WORDS”.  These are words that “pop up” often in books and they are sight words that we practice reading at school.
